MnDOT invites Mora area residents, businesses to public event June 5 for Hwy 65 and 23 study findings

BAXTER, Minn. – The Minnesota Department of Transportation invites the traveling public, area residents and businesses to learn about the preferred design alternatives on Wednesday, June 5, for the Highway 65 and Highway 23 corridor in Mora.

The meeting will take place from 4:30 p.m. to 6:30 p.m., Wednesday, June 5, at Mora City Hall, 101 S Lake St., Mora, MN.
There will be no formal presentation. Attendees are encouraged to come and go at their leisure.

MnDOT project staff will review the preferred design alternatives and share information on findings from the corridor study in Mora, which covers the area on Highway 65 between Ninth Street and the Ann River bridge and Highway 23 between Highway 65 and Mahogany Street. The study identifies future safety and access needs throughout the corridor segment. The study will inform plans for reconstruction in 2030.
